1.注释:
1.单行注释:#
2.多行注释:""""""
输出到控制台
print(“输出到控制台”)
键盘输入
input("请输入::)
2.变量
python运行时命令电脑上开辟一个内存空间,该内存空间用来存储值
语法:变量名 = 值
获取变量的内存地址:
a=“123”
print(id(a))
3.标识符
标识符就是程序员在程序中自定义的变量名 、函数名、类的名字
规则:1.标识符由字母、数字、下划线组成
2.所有标识符可以包括英文、数字以及下划线(_),但不能以数字开头、
3.标识符是严格区分大小写的
4.命名规则:
小驼峰式命名法:myName
大驼峰式命名法:LastName
下划线“_”来连接所有的单词
(根据公司的规则来)
5.关键字
import keyword
print(keyword.kwlist)
['False', 'None', 'True', 'and', 'as', 'assert', 'async', 'await', 'break', 'class', 'continue',
'def', 'del', 'elif', 'else', 'except', 'finally', 'for', 'from', 'global', 'if', 'import', 'in',
'is', 'lambda', 'nonlocal', 'not', 'or', 'pass', 'raise', 'return', 'try', 'while', 'with', 'yield']
6.数据类型
查看变量类型:type(num)
7.算数运算符
8.比较运算符
9.赋值运算符
10.身份运算符
11.运算符优先级
面试题:
1.变量的类型由什么决定
变量占用内存空间的大小(f:4 d:8 c:1 i:4)
数据的存储形式(整数:二进制 小数的小数部分为指数形式)
合法的表数范围
由于在开发中需要多种数据类型来满足不同的需求,同时还需要提高代码的执行效率,所以按不同的数据存储的方式和占据空间以及执行效率的不同划分为不同的数据类型
2.Python中有哪些常见的类型
Number(int(整型) float(浮点型) complex(复数))
布尔类型(True False)
String(字符串)
List(列表)
Tuple(元组)
Dictionary(字典)
3.is和==的区别
==比较操作符,is身份运算符
==:值相同就行,不用纠结存储id
is:值不仅要相同,存储id也要相同
4.Python中输入和输出分别对应的函数是哪个?
输入:input
输出:print
5.变量的语法结构、什么时候要使用变量?
变量名=值
当一个数据需要暂存在内存中而参与后期运算时,需要通过变量告诉计算机存储该变量的值
6.获取变量地址值和类型分别是哪个?
id()
type()
7.标识符的两种命名方式是什么?请举例?
小驼峰式命名法:myName
大驼峰式命名法:LastName